At the eighth Sprint Review, the stakeholders are upset that the product being built is not what they expected and will incur additional costs that was not planned for.
What may have led to this?

  • A. The Scrum Master has not been reporting on the progress of the Scrum Team. The Product Owner has not been managing the Development Team's tasks effectively. The Development Team has not been improving their velocity.
  • B. The Scrum Master has not ensured that the project is transparent. The Product Owner has not made the stakeholders aware of the progress of the project. The stakeholders have not been attending the Sprint Reviews.
  • C. The Scrum Master has not been attending the Daily Standup. The Product Owner has not been using the Gantt chart correctly. The Stakeholders has not been invited to the Sprint Retrospectives.
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: B 🗳️
Scrum requires significant aspects of the process to be visible to those responsible for the outcome. This includes transparency with internal and external stakeholders.
